Tell whether the lines through the given points are parallel, perpendicular, or neither.
Nataly_w [17]

Step-by-step explanation:

The slope of a line connecting two points is:

m = (y₂ − y₁) / (x₂ − x₁)

The slope of line 1 is:

m = (4 − 0) / (7 − 1)

m = 2/3

The slope of line 2 is:

m = (6 − 0) / (3 − 7)

m = -3/2

Parallel lines have equal slopes.

Perpendicular lines have opposite inverse slopes.

2/3 and -3/2 are opposite inverses, so the lines are perpendicular.
